On Fri, 10 Oct 2014 09:26:08 +0000 (UTC), Rich wrote:
> Bit Twister <BitTwister@mouse-potato.com> wrote:

>> Random passwords are easier to crack.
>
> No.  "properly random" means the password should look like this:
>
> =~dWx9C9pJq04lGMKh~C
>
> or this
>
> V064pb+e6)Sf/K?20/hf

Yes I understood the word random.

> Which are not "easier to crack" but quite the opposite, significantly
> harder (note - the above two are not in use, and as they are randomly
> generated, never will be).

Frap, I can not find the article showing random password crack time was way
less than a funky word string.

Hardcore crackers are using several video card gpus to crack passwords.

>> Use a funky phrase like
>> my dog eats concrete. 
>> Feel free to sprinkle in numbers and !@#$%^&*()_+= characters.
>
> Not at all safe.  The automatic crackers already know how to generate
> phrases with numbers and those characters sprinkled in, so that is
> actually easier to crack than a "properly random" password.

I completely agree with you with a single password.

Since I can not find the article, we are at the end of this discussion.

Now assuming Fedora 20 has a 3 second delay between each failed
attempt, it is going to take quite awhile to finally hit on any
reasonable strong phrase as the password.

Just don't use any quote or current buzz words.
